PHD in Biochemistry at Pt. B.D. Sharma University of Health Sciences, Rohtak

Pandit B.D. Sharma University of Health Sciences, Rohtak, a leading state university established in 2008 in Haryana, holds NAAC 'A' grade accreditation. It offers diverse UG, PG, and doctoral health science programs, including flagship MBBS and B.Pharma. The university provides a robust academic environment on its 350-acre campus.

About the Specialization

What is Biochemistry at Pt. B.D. Sharma University of Health Sciences, Rohtak Rohtak?

This PhD Biochemistry program at Pandit Bhagwat Dayal Sharma University of Health Sciences focuses on advanced biochemical research and its applications in health sciences. It delves into the molecular mechanisms of disease, drug development, and diagnostic tools, aligning with India''''s growing p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ors. The program emphasizes translational research, preparing scholars for high-impact contributions. The industry demand in India for skilled biochemists in research and development is significant.

Who Should Apply?

This program is ideal for medical and science postgraduates (MD/MSc Medical Biochemistry or related fields) seeking deep specialization in biochemical research. It caters to fresh graduates aspiring for academic or R&D roles, and working professionals in clinical labs or pharma who wish to pursue advanced scientific inquiry. Candidates should possess a strong foundation in biochemistry, molecular biology, and research aptitude.

Why Choose This Course?

Graduates of this program can expect career paths in medical research institutions, pharmaceutical companies, diagnostic laboratories, and academia across India. Entry to experienced salary ranges from INR 6-18 lakhs per annum, with significant growth for those contributing to novel discoveries. The program fosters critical thinking and problem-solving skills, aligning with requirements for senior research scientist or faculty positions.

Student Success Practices

Foundation Stage

Master Research Methodology and Biostatistics- (Semester 1)

Thoroughly understand the principles of research design, data analysis, and ethical conduct as taught in coursework. Actively participate in workshops and utilize online resources for statistical software proficiency to build a strong analytical base.

Tools & Resources

SPSS, R, PubMed, Google Scholar, NPTEL courses on research methodology

Career Connection

Forms the bedrock for designing robust research studies, interpreting data accurately, and ensuring ethical compliance, crucial for any research-oriented career in health sciences.

Intensive Literature Review and Thesis Proposal Development- (Semester 1-2)

Engage in a systematic and exhaustive review of relevant scientific literature to identify research gaps and formulate a clear, impactful research hypothesis. Develop a comprehensive thesis proposal under expert mentorship from faculty members.

Tools & Resources

EndNote, Mendeley for citation management, Scopus, Web of Science for literature search, department seminars

Career Connection

Essential for defining a feasible and significant research project, a key skill for independent researchers and future grant applications in India''''s competitive research landscape.
